Interpretable AI: Making Black Boxes Explainable

Interpretable AI: Making Black Boxes Explainable

The Enigma of Black Box AI

I have always been fascinated by the power and potential of artificial intelligence (AI). The ability of machines to learn, adapt, and make decisions in complex environments is truly remarkable. However, as AI systems have become more sophisticated, they have also become increasingly opaque, often operating as “black boxes” that defy simple explanation. This lack of interpretability is a significant challenge, as it can undermine trust, limit accountability, and hinder the real-world application of these powerful technologies.

As an AI enthusiast and researcher, I have dedicated a significant portion of my career to exploring the concept of interpretable AI. In this in-depth article, I will delve into the importance of interpretability, the various approaches to making AI systems more transparent, and the potential benefits and drawbacks of these methods. I will also share real-world case studies and examples to illustrate the practical implications of interpretable AI.

Demystifying the Black Box

One of the fundamental challenges with modern AI systems is their inherent complexity. These systems often rely on neural networks, deep learning algorithms, and other advanced techniques that can make it difficult to understand how they arrive at their decisions. This “black box” problem is particularly prevalent in areas like image recognition, natural language processing, and predictive analytics, where the algorithms may be processing vast amounts of data and making highly nuanced judgments.

The lack of interpretability in AI systems can have serious consequences. For example, in high-stakes decision-making scenarios, such as healthcare or finance, it is crucial that the reasoning behind a decision can be clearly explained and validated. Without this, there is a risk of bias, discrimination, or unintended consequences that could have significant impacts on individuals and society.

Furthermore, the opaqueness of AI systems can also hinder their adoption and integration into real-world applications. If users and stakeholders cannot understand how a system arrived at a particular outcome, they are less likely to trust and embrace the technology, which can limit its potential impact.

Unveiling the Inner Workings of AI

In response to the black box problem, researchers and practitioners have developed a range of techniques and approaches to make AI systems more interpretable and explainable. These include:

Explainable AI (XAI)

Explainable AI, or XAI, is a field of study that focuses on developing AI systems that can provide explanations for their decisions and behaviors. This can involve techniques like feature importance analysis, which helps identify the key factors that influence an AI model’s predictions, or counterfactual explanations, which demonstrate how an outcome would change if certain input variables were different.

Interpretable Machine Learning

Interpretable machine learning is a complementary approach that emphasizes the development of AI models that are inherently more transparent and easier to understand. This can include the use of simpler, more interpretable algorithms, such as decision trees or linear models, or the incorporation of explanatory components into more complex models, like attention mechanisms in neural networks.

Hybrid Approaches

Some researchers have proposed hybrid approaches that combine the strengths of both interpretable and black box AI models. For example, a system might use a complex, high-performance AI model to make initial predictions, and then use an interpretable model to provide explanations and validate the results.

Ethical and Regulatory Considerations

As the field of interpretable AI continues to evolve, there are also important ethical and regulatory considerations to address. Policymakers and industry leaders are grappling with questions of accountability, bias, and the appropriate use of these technologies, particularly in sensitive domains like healthcare, finance, and criminal justice.

Real-World Applications of Interpretable AI

To bring these concepts to life, let’s explore some real-world examples of interpretable AI in action:

Case Study: Improving Healthcare Outcomes

One of the most promising applications of interpretable AI is in the healthcare industry. Imagine a system that can analyze patient data, medical histories, and treatment outcomes to predict the likelihood of a certain condition or disease. By using interpretable AI techniques, such as feature importance analysis and counterfactual explanations, the system can provide clinicians with clear, actionable insights that can inform treatment decisions and improve patient outcomes.

In a study published in the Journal of the American Medical Informatics Association, researchers developed an interpretable AI model to predict the risk of surgical site infections (SSIs) in patients undergoing orthopedic procedures. The model was able to identify the key risk factors, such as patient age, body mass index, and surgical duration, and provide clinicians with explanations for the predicted outcomes. This information allowed healthcare providers to tailor their protocols and interventions to address the specific risk factors, ultimately reducing the incidence of SSIs.

Case Study: Enhancing Financial Decision-Making

Another area where interpretable AI is making a significant impact is in the financial sector. Financial institutions are increasingly turning to AI-powered models to assist with tasks like loan approval, investment portfolio optimization, and fraud detection. However, the complexity of these models can make it challenging to understand the underlying logic and justify the decisions they make.

One example of interpretable AI in finance is the work of researchers at the University of Pennsylvania’s Wharton School. They developed an AI-based system to predict the risk of loan defaults, using techniques like SHAP (Shapley Additive Explanations) to identify the key factors that influenced the model’s predictions. By providing clear, transparent explanations for their risk assessments, the system helped lenders make more informed and accountable decisions, ultimately improving the overall efficiency and fairness of the lending process.

Case Study: Fostering Trust in Autonomous Vehicles

The development of autonomous vehicles is another domain where interpretable AI is crucial. As these vehicles become more sophisticated, it is essential that their decision-making processes are transparent and understandable to both passengers and other road users.

Researchers at the University of Michigan have been exploring ways to make autonomous vehicle AI more interpretable. One approach they have investigated is the use of “explainable planning,” which involves generating and explaining the reasoning behind the vehicle’s actions, such as lane changes, braking, and accelerating. By providing clear, real-time explanations for these decisions, the researchers aim to build trust and acceptance among the public, ultimately paving the way for the widespread adoption of autonomous vehicles.

The Future of Interpretable AI

As the field of interpretable AI continues to evolve, I believe we will see even more exciting developments and applications in the years to come. Some of the key trends and areas of focus include:

Advances in Interpretable Model Architectures

Researchers are constantly exploring new ways to build AI models that are inherently more interpretable, such as incorporating attention mechanisms, self-explanatory components, and other design features that make the decision-making process more transparent.

Integrating Interpretability into the AI Development Lifecycle

Instead of treating interpretability as an afterthought, there is a growing emphasis on embedding interpretability considerations into the entire AI development process, from data collection and model training to deployment and monitoring.

Multidisciplinary Collaboration

Interpretable AI is a highly interdisciplinary field, requiring expertise in areas like machine learning, cognitive science, human-computer interaction, and ethics. As a result, we are seeing increased collaboration between researchers, practitioners, and stakeholders from diverse backgrounds to tackle the challenges of interpretability.

Regulatory and Policy Frameworks

As the use of AI becomes more widespread, there is a growing need for regulatory and policy frameworks that ensure the responsible and ethical development and deployment of these technologies. Interpretable AI will play a crucial role in meeting these requirements and building public trust.

Conclusion: Unlocking the Full Potential of AI

In conclusion, the quest for interpretable AI is not just an academic exercise; it is a critical step in unlocking the full potential of these powerful technologies. By making AI systems more transparent and explainable, we can enhance trust, improve accountability, and ultimately, drive more responsible and impactful applications of AI across a wide range of industries and domains.

As an AI enthusiast and researcher, I am deeply committed to advancing the field of interpretable AI. Through ongoing research, collaboration, and real-world implementation, I believe we can create a future where AI systems are not only highly capable, but also highly understandable – a future where the “black box” is transformed into a transparent and accessible window into the inner workings of these remarkable technologies.

Facebook
Pinterest
Twitter
LinkedIn

Newsletter

Signup our newsletter to get update information, news, insight or promotions.

Latest Post

Related Article